Output dac5da89a5cf2b3f1a317a303a2813a7077727987b6c0a161fc3de847be6052c:0

value
7895333
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52b61079360aedbb01e6abc2b066bb93cdeabb72 OP_EQUAL
address
39EMSKu1xfnQhmKUFt4qj2HVQo2J4LANFR
transaction
dac5da89a5cf2b3f1a317a303a2813a7077727987b6c0a161fc3de847be6052c
confirmations
52864
spent
true